现代密码学教程答案解析-第二版

1星 需积分: 50 89 下载量 165 浏览量 更新于2024-07-19 9 收藏 2.49MB DOC 举报
"现代密码学-课后答案-第二版,包含书后习题全解,适合配合北邮密码学教材使用,适用于期末复习" 本文将深入探讨现代密码学中的核心概念,结合提供的部分题目和答案,我们将逐一解析相关知识点。 1. 密码学基础: - 信息安全的目标包括机密性、完整性、可用性、认证性和不可否认性。这些要素确保了数据的安全性和可靠性。 - 经典的信息安全三要素是机密性(防止未经授权的访问)、完整性和可用性(确保数据未被修改且随时可以访问)。 2. 攻击类型: - 攻击分为两类:主动攻击(如篡改、伪造、重放等)和被动攻击(如监听、截取信息流)。 - 根据对信息流的影响,可将攻击进一步细分为中断、截取、篡改、伪造和重放。 3. 密码学历史: - 香农在1949年的论文奠定了密码学的理论基础,使得密码学成为一门独立学科。 - 1976年,Diffie和Hellman提出了公开密钥密码思想,标志着现代密码学的开端。 - RSA公钥密码体制的提出(1978年,由Rivest、Shamir和Adleman提出)是密码学发展中的重要里程碑。 4. 密码法规: - 密码法规对于现代社会的密码管理和信息保护至关重要。 5. 密码学分类: - 密码学分为密码编码学(设计密码系统)和密码分析学(破解密码系统)。 - 一个保密系统由明文、密文、密钥、加密算法和解密算法组成。 - 密码体制按密钥策略分为对称密钥(如DES、AES)和非对称密钥(如RSA、ECC)。 6. 对称与非对称密码体制: - 对称密码体制使用相同的密钥进行加密和解密,包括分组密码(如AES)和序列密码(如RC4)。 - 非对称密码体制使用一对密钥,一个用于加密,另一个用于解密,如RSA、ECC。 7. 传统密码学: - 传统密码学算法主要依赖于字符置换和代换。 - 置换密码包括列置换和周期转置。 - 代换密码分为单表代换和多表代换,如仿射密码(线性变换)。 这些知识点构成了现代密码学的基础,学习和理解它们对于密码学的学习者来说至关重要,尤其是在准备期末考试时。通过解答书中习题,可以更好地巩固这些概念并提高实际应用能力。